Brief Summary
Heart Failure (HF) is a complex disease associated with the highest burden of cost to the healthcare system. The cardiopulmonary exercise test (CPET) is instrumental in determining the prognosis of patients with HF. This multicentre study will validate whether aggregate biometric data from the Apple Watch combined with demographic, cardiac, and biomarker testing can improve our ability to predict heart failure outcomes among a diverse outpatient HF population.

Outcome Measures
Primary Outcomes (2)
Prediction of CPET parameters
Measure predictive power of cardiorespiratory fitness estimated from data obtained from Apple Watch in combination with clinical and/or demographical data against reductions in measures of cardiorespiratory fitness in heart failure patients such as peak VO2
7 months
Prediction of worsening heart failure
Measure predictive power of cardiorespiratory fitness estimated from data obtained from Apple Watch in combination with clinical and/or demographical data against worsening heart failure
7 months

Eligibility Criteria
Adult (\>18 years of age), ambulatory heart failure patients currently followed by the University Health Network and hospitals in multi-site validation study.
You may qualify if:
- broad age range (\> 18 years of age)
- NT-proBNP \> 400 or 1000 if in AF
- Within 3 months post discharge from HF hospitalization/ HF ED visit/ HF rapid clinic visit with intensification of diuretic therapy
- NYHA functional class I-IV, heart failure with reduced and preserved ejection fraction
- Literacy in English
- Patient provided informed consent
You may not qualify if:
- Unable to perform a CPET based on the standard protocol
- End stage renal disease requiring dialysis
- Living with LVAD
- MRP deems patient unfit for the study
- Post heart transplant
